    I have no rub on cab mounts , no touching on plastic or fenders. At full lock left or right I have sidewall touching the frame but That does not bother me because I just don't turn full lock unless I really have to, and sidewall rub does not catch or rip lugs. Yes I could run wheel spacers, But I'm not going to the mall. ( been to the mall 1 time in 7 years to buy a new gun ) I'm going into the rocks, sand and mud
